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s that you may need window leak water damage restoration: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ice a musty smell in your home that persists even after cleaning, it may be a sign that you have a water damage issue. Our team can help you detect and repair the source of the problem before it gets out of hand.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leaky roof or a burst pipe. If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s essential to investigate the source of the problem as soon as possible. Our team can help you identify the cause and make the necessary repairs to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your flooring is uneven or damaged, it may be a sign that you have a water damage issue. Our team can help you detect and repair the source of the problem before it gets out of hand.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your paint or wallpaper is peeling or bubbling, it may be a sign that you have a water damage issue. Our team can help you detect and repair the source of the problem before it gets out of hand.

Window Leak Water Damage Restoration Cost In Lino Lakes, MN

The cost of window leak water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lino Lakes, MN.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Water Damage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Dehumidification and Moisture Control $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Inspection and Testing $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Insurance Claims Help $0 – $500 Severity of damage, complexity of claims process
